The changing practice of transurethral prostatectomy: a comparison of cases performed in 1990 and 2000

Abstract

At present, TURP is in decline, with urinary retention being the commonest indication. The population at present is older but this does not carry additional co-morbidity. The weight of resection has not altered, although surgery currently takes longer to perform.
